Yes SDS is a Subdivision Surface Object. You are not forced to share the file, but I can't give you the help you are asking for without it, so.... up to you - do you want the help or not !? 🙂

 

There is no single button that converts triangles to quads in a way that will help here. The mesh has simply been built incorrectly, and with not enough attention to quality topology, so to fix that you need to pretty much start again any area that contains a triangle unless you have sufficient modelling skill to be able to solve that to quads in-place within the existing mesh, which seems unlikely given that you are needing to ask about this...

 

Lastly, the way to post screenshots that show us wires is to disable the SDS cage in filter menu, so we only see 1 set of lines, change display mode to isoparms or wireframe, disable any SDS so we can see the underlying base topology clearly, get a single view full screen and then print-screen it, after which you can just Ctrl+V (paste) it into a post.
